/*
|
|
============================================================
|
|
Demo File: Range_Breakout_EA - Signal Logic Showcase
|
|
Category: Breakout
|
|
Platform: MetaTrader 4 (MQL4)
|
|
Version: 1.0
|
|
Author: Giacomo Cipolat Bares
|
|
Portfolio: MQL4 Expert Advisors Portfolio
|
|
============================================================
|
|
|
|
Description:
|
|
This is a simplified public demo derived from the full
|
|
Range Breakout EA.
|
|
|
|
Included in this demo:
|
|
- range high/low detection
|
|
- breakout trigger calculation
|
|
- breakout buffer logic
|
|
- one-breakout-per-range logic
|
|
- breakout cooldown logic
|
|
- basic on-chart signal output
|
|
|
|
Excluded from this demo:
|
|
- order execution
|
|
- risk management engine
|
|
- break-even / trailing stop
|
|
- retry logic
|
|
- broker protection handling
|
|
- full production trade framework
|
|
- chart visualization layer
|
|
============================================================
|
|
*/

#property strict
|
|
#property version "1.00"
|
|
|
|
//========================= INPUTS ==================================
|
|
input string __01_BreakoutSettings = "01 ======== Breakout Settings ========";
|
|
input int BreakoutBars = 20;
|
|
input double BreakoutBufferPips = 0.5;
|
|
input bool UseCloseBreakout = false;
|
|
input bool OneBreakoutPerRange = true;
|
|
input bool ResetRangeAfterTrade = true;
|
|
input bool UseBreakoutCooldown = true;
|
|
input int BreakoutCooldownBars = 5;
|
|
|
|
//======================= BREAKOUT GLOBALS ==========================
|
|
double g_lastRangeHigh = 0.0;
|
|
double g_lastRangeLow = 0.0;
|
|
bool g_rangeAlreadyTraded = false;
|
|
int g_lastTradeBarIndex = -1;
|
|
|
|
//======================= GENERAL GLOBALS ===========================
|
|
double g_point;
|
|
double g_pip;
|
|
int g_digits;
|
|
datetime g_lastBarTime = 0;
|
|
|
|
//+------------------------------------------------------------------+
|
|
//| Expert initialization |
|
|
//+------------------------------------------------------------------+
|
|
int OnInit()
|
|
{
|
|
g_point = Point;
|
|
g_digits = Digits;
|
|
|
|
if(g_digits == 5 || g_digits == 3)
|
|
g_pip = g_point * 10.0;
|
|
else
|
|
g_pip = g_point;
|
|
|
|
Print("Range Breakout demo initialized");
|
|
return(INIT_SUCCEEDED);
|
|
}
|
|
|
|
//+------------------------------------------------------------------+
|
|
//| Detects a new bar |
|
|
//+------------------------------------------------------------------+
|
|
bool IsNewBar()
|
|
{
|
|
datetime currentBarTime = iTime(NULL, 0, 0);
|
|
|
|
if(currentBarTime != g_lastBarTime)
|
|
{
|
|
g_lastBarTime = currentBarTime;
|
|
return true;
|
|
}
|
|
|
|
return false;
|
|
}
|
|
|
|
//+------------------------------------------------------------------+
|
|
//| Range high from previous N bars |
|
|
//+------------------------------------------------------------------+
|
|
double GetBreakoutHigh()
|
|
{
|
|
int highestIndex = iHighest(NULL, 0, MODE_HIGH, BreakoutBars, 1);
|
|
return High[highestIndex];
|
|
}
|
|
|
|
//+------------------------------------------------------------------+
|
|
//| Range low from previous N bars |
|
|
//+------------------------------------------------------------------+
|
|
double GetBreakoutLow()
|
|
{
|
|
int lowestIndex = iLowest(NULL, 0, MODE_LOW, BreakoutBars, 1);
|
|
return Low[lowestIndex];
|
|
}
|
|
|
|
//+------------------------------------------------------------------+
|
|
//| Bullish breakout condition |
|
|
//+------------------------------------------------------------------+
|
|
bool IsBullishBreakout()
|
|
{
|
|
double breakoutHigh = GetBreakoutHigh();
|
|
double triggerPrice = breakoutHigh + BreakoutBufferPips * g_pip;
|
|
|
|
if(UseCloseBreakout)
|
|
return (Close[1] > triggerPrice);
|
|
|
|
return (Ask > triggerPrice);
|
|
}
|
|
|
|
//+------------------------------------------------------------------+
|
|
//| Bearish breakout condition |
|
|
//+------------------------------------------------------------------+
|
|
bool IsBearishBreakout()
|
|
{
|
|
double breakoutLow = GetBreakoutLow();
|
|
double triggerPrice = breakoutLow - BreakoutBufferPips * g_pip;
|
|
|
|
if(UseCloseBreakout)
|
|
return (Close[1] < triggerPrice);
|
|
|
|
return (Bid < triggerPrice);
|
|
}
|
|
|
|
//+------------------------------------------------------------------+
|
|
//| Checks if current range is same as previous tracked range |
|
|
//+------------------------------------------------------------------+
|
|
bool IsSameRange(double rangeHigh, double rangeLow)
|
|
{
|
|
if(MathAbs(rangeHigh - g_lastRangeHigh) < (g_point * 0.5) &&
|
|
MathAbs(rangeLow - g_lastRangeLow) < (g_point * 0.5))
|
|
{
|
|
return true;
|
|
}
|
|
|
|
return false;
|
|
}
|
|
|
|
//+------------------------------------------------------------------+
|
|
//| Updates tracked breakout range |
|
|
//+------------------------------------------------------------------+
|
|
void UpdateRangeState()
|
|
{
|
|
double currentRangeHigh = GetBreakoutHigh();
|
|
double currentRangeLow = GetBreakoutLow();
|
|
|
|
if(!IsSameRange(currentRangeHigh, currentRangeLow))
|
|
{
|
|
g_lastRangeHigh = currentRangeHigh;
|
|
g_lastRangeLow = currentRangeLow;
|
|
|
|
if(ResetRangeAfterTrade)
|
|
g_rangeAlreadyTraded = false;
|
|
}
|
|
}
|
|
|
|
//+------------------------------------------------------------------+
|
|
//| One breakout per range filter |
|
|
//+------------------------------------------------------------------+
|
|
bool CanTradeCurrentRange()
|
|
{
|
|
if(!OneBreakoutPerRange)
|
|
return true;
|
|
|
|
if(g_rangeAlreadyTraded)
|
|
return false;
|
|
|
|
return true;
|
|
}
|
|
|
|
//+------------------------------------------------------------------+
|
|
//| Breakout cooldown filter |
|
|
//+------------------------------------------------------------------+
|
|
bool BreakoutCooldownPassed()
|
|
{
|
|
if(!UseBreakoutCooldown)
|
|
return true;
|
|
|
|
if(g_lastTradeBarIndex < 0)
|
|
return true;
|
|
|
|
int barsPassed = Bars - g_lastTradeBarIndex;
|
|
|
|
if(barsPassed >= BreakoutCooldownBars)
|
|
return true;
|
|
|
|
return false;
|
|
}
|
|
|
|
//+------------------------------------------------------------------+
|
|
//| Demo buy signal wrapper |
|
|
//+------------------------------------------------------------------+
|
|
bool BuySignal()
|
|
{
|
|
if(!CanTradeCurrentRange())
|
|
return false;
|
|
|
|
if(!BreakoutCooldownPassed())
|
|
return false;
|
|
|
|
return IsBullishBreakout();
|
|
}
|
|
|
|
//+------------------------------------------------------------------+
|
|
//| Demo sell signal wrapper |
|
|
//+------------------------------------------------------------------+
|
|
bool SellSignal()
|
|
{
|
|
if(!CanTradeCurrentRange())
|
|
return false;
|
|
|
|
if(!BreakoutCooldownPassed())
|
|
return false;
|
|
|
|
return IsBearishBreakout();
|
|
}
|
|
|
|
//+------------------------------------------------------------------+
|
|
//| Expert tick |
|
|
//+------------------------------------------------------------------+
|
|
void OnTick()
|
|
{
|
|
if(!IsNewBar())
|
|
return;
|
|
|
|
UpdateRangeState();
|
|
|
|
if(BuySignal())
|
|
{
|
|
g_lastTradeBarIndex = Bars;
|
|
g_rangeAlreadyTraded = true;
|
|
Comment("Demo Signal: BUY breakout detected");
|
|
return;
|
|
}
|
|
|
|
if(SellSignal())
|
|
{
|
|
g_lastTradeBarIndex = Bars;
|
|
g_rangeAlreadyTraded = true;
|
|
Comment("Demo Signal: SELL breakout detected");
|
|
return;
|
|
}
|
|
|
|
Comment("Demo Signal: No valid breakout");
|
|
} |
